General description
A convenient set that offers several highly selective serine/threonine kinase inhibitors. Kinases play an important role in numerous signaling cascades. Highly selective protein kinase inhibitors are useful for dissecting these cascades to determine which specific kinases are involved in producing particular biological effects. The Serine/Threonine Kinase Inhibitor Set contains the following highly selective serine/ threonine kinase inhibitors in one convenient set:
• Bisindolylmaleimide I (Cat. No. 203290), 250 µg
• H-89, Dihydrochloride (Cat. No. 371963), 1 mg
• KN-93 (Cat. No. 422708), 1 mg
• ML-7 (Cat. No. 475880), 1 mg
• Protein Kinase G Inhibitor (Cat. No. 370654), 1 mg
• Staurosporine (Cat. No. 569397), 100 µg

Preparation Note
Following reconstitution, aliquot and freeze (-20°C). Stock solutions of each inhibitor are stable for up to 3 months at -20°C.
